2008 Conclave

The Conclave is the premier event of the the Southern Council Federation of Flyfishers, held each year in Mountain Home, Arkansas.  It was held Thursday, Friday, and Saturday, October 2nd thru October 4th, 2008. The business meeting will be held Sunday morning the 5th.

Mark your calendars right now for the Wayne E & Catherine Moore Youth program for 2008 at the Southern Council Conclave – Saturday, October 4th in Mountain Home, Arkansas at the fabled waters of Dry Run Creek. It will be one of the best decisions you have made in a long time!

Youth Conclave at Dry Run Creek

Ozark Fly Fishers will be the hosting chapter for the youth program this coming fall. If you are a parent, a grandparent, a great grandparent, an uncle, an aunt, or in any size, shape or form connected to a child under the age of 16, you should seriously consider taking them to the Southern Council Conclave this coming fall. It is one of the most amazing places to fish for trout (rainbows, browns, brook, and cutthroats) on planet earth. There are reported to be more than 10,000 trout per mile. The requirements: 1) Flies only 2) Barbless Hooks only 3) Catch and Release only 4) Must be under 16 or handicapped. We will have all of the gear, stream-helpers (guides), lunch provided, and lots of other fun and giveaways for the kids. This is an absolutely amazing experience for the kids and you will have memories for you and them that will last a lifetime. River Berry Players

Aistrope familyLulie, age 14, Billy, age 12, and Railan, age 10 — children of Bill and Susie Aistrope from Stoutland, MO — will be featured during an evening at Conclave. They play bluegrass, country and gospel music on the fiddle and guitar. They have been performing for several years in Newburg at Lyric Live Theatre.
